The magic of children's gardens : inspiring through creative design / Lolly Tai ; with a foreword by Jane L. Taylor.

"Landscape architect Lolly Tai provides the primary goals, concepts, and key considerations for designing outdoor spaces that are attractive and suitable for children, especially in urban environments.
